Abstract
The utility model relates to a pipe shell with extruded polystyrene foam plastics. The utility model mainly solves the problems of easy water absorption, low intensity, poor environmental protection and high cost of the existing polyurethane foaming heat preservation anticorrosive layer. The utility model is characterized in that a shell body (1) is composed of two extruded polystyrene foam plastics equivalent bodies with semi-circular ring-shaped sections. The two extruded polystyrene foam plastics equivalent bodies are buckled together. An adhesive layer (2) is coated on the adjoining surface of the two extruded polystyrene foam plastics equivalent bodies. The pipe shell with extruded polystyrene foam plastics has the characteristics of good heat preservation anticorrosive performance, high strength, good environmental protection performance and low cost and has no water absorption.
Description
Technical field:
The utility model relates to a kind of pipeline insulation antiseptic spare, especially extrusion molding polystyrene polyfoam shell.
Background technique:
In the north, for the conveying that makes liquid or gas material can normally be carried out, must carry out insulation antiseptic on the accumulating pipeline handles, usually adopt polyurethane foamed heat insulating outside the main body pipe anticorrosion at present, this polyurethane foamed heat insulating anticorrosive coat easily absorbs water, and intensity is lower, and is fragile, and the cost height, the feature of environmental protection is poor.
The model utility content:
Existing polyurethane foamed heat insulating anticorrosive coat easily absorbs water, intensity is lower in order to overcome, feature of environmental protection difference and the high deficiency of cost, the utility model provides a kind of extrusion molding polystyrene polyfoam shell, this extrusion molding polystyrene polyfoam shell have do not absorb water, the insulation antiseptic performance is good, intensity is high, the feature of environmental protection reaches the low characteristics of cost well.
The technical solution of the utility model is: this extrusion molding polystyrene polyfoam shell comprises housing, and housing is that the extrusion molding polystyrene polyfoam peer-to-peer in two semi-annular shape cross sections fastens, and scribbles glue-line at its place, mating face.
The nominal diameter of above-mentioned housing is 15~2000mm.
The utlity model has following beneficial effect: owing to take such scheme, the intensity height of extrusion molding polystyrene polyfoam does not absorb water, and the feature of environmental protection is good and cost is low, fastens behind the interface gluing with two peer-to-peers when mounted, and is easy to use.
